Korean Beef Tacos Damn Delicious

Instructions. In a large bowl, whisk together beef broth, soy sauce, brown sugar, garlic, oil, vinegar, ginger, sriracha and pepper. Place meat and onion in the slow cooker and stir in the prepared beef broth mixture. Cover and cook on low for 7 to 8 hours or high heat, 3 to 4 hours.


Korean Ground Beef Tacos Modern Farmhouse Eats

In a large b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, brown sugar, sesame oil, minced garlic, grated ginger, and black pepper. Add the sliced beef to the bowl and toss to coat. Marinate for at least 30 minutes, or overnight. Heat a large skillet over high heat.
